Backed by Science

CBD - Cannabidiol 1000mg

  • What is it?

CBD (Cannabidiol) is a non-psychoactive compound derived from the cannabis plant. Unlike THC, it doesn’t cause a “high” and is widely studied for its therapeutic effects.

  • What are the benefits for Pain?

CBD interacts with the body’s endocannabinoid system, which regulates pain, inflammation, and immune responses. It is known to reduce chronic pain by impacting the endocannabinoid receptor activity, reducing inflammation, and interacting with neurotransmitters.

  • How does it contribute to Wellness?

CBD contributes to overall wellness by promoting balance (homeostasis) within the body. Its anti-inflammatory properties also help reduce pain and discomfort from various conditions, enhancing quality of life.

  • Which problems can it solve?

CBD can help alleviate chronic pain conditions such as arthritis, fibromyalgia, and neuropathy. It may also reduce pain from injuries, surgeries, and general muscle soreness.

  • Related Study

Cannabinoids in the management of difficult to treat pain

This 2018 study found CBD effective in managing chronic pain by reducing inflammation and desensitizing pain pathways.

Arnica Powder

  • What is it?

Arnica is a plant from the sunflower family known for its use in homeopathic medicine and pain relief applications, typically used in topical form for injuries and bruises.

  • What are the benefits for Pain?

Arnica contains sesquiterpene lactones, which are anti-inflammatory compounds that reduce pain, swelling, and muscle soreness. It’s effective for relieving osteoarthritis pain and post-traumatic injuries.

  • How does it contribute to Wellness?

Arnica helps decrease inflammation and promote faster recovery from injuries, making it a go-to for people recovering from muscle strains, bruises, and sprains. Its use accelerates healing and reduces downtime from physical activities.

  • Which problems can it solve?

Arnica can alleviate joint pain from arthritis, muscle soreness from overexertion, and pain from bruises, sprains, and fractures.

  • Related Study

Clinical Trials, Potential Mechanisms, and Adverse Effects of Arnica as an Adjunct Medication for Pain Management

The study on Arnica highlights its effectiveness in reducing various types of pain, including post-operative, arthritis, and musculoskeletal pain. Clinical trials showed that Arnica significantly decreased pain after surgeries, such as hand surgery and varicose vein procedures, often matching the efficacy of conventional painkillers like diclofenac but with fewer side effects. Arnica also reduced pain in patients with hand and knee osteoarthritis, and in sports-related injuries like ankle sprains and exercise-induced muscle pain.

In conclusion, Arnica serves as a beneficial adjunct therapy for managing both acute and chronic pain, offering comparable relief to standard medications with fewer adverse effects, making it particularly useful in post-surgery recovery, arthritis management, and sports injuries.

Açaí Berry

  • What is it?

Acai is a dark purple fruit native to the Amazon, known for its high antioxidant content and anti-inflammatory properties.

  • What are the benefits for Pain?

Acai’s high concentration of anthocyanins helps to reduce oxidative stress and inflammation, which are major contributors to chronic pain conditions such as arthritis.

  • How does it contribute to Wellness?

As a superfood, acai boosts immune function and fights free radicals, contributing to overall health and vitality. Its anti-inflammatory effects help reduce pain, swelling, and stiffness, leading to better joint mobility and physical comfort.

  • Which problems can it solve?

Acai helps alleviate chronic pain caused by inflammation, particularly in conditions such as arthritis, joint pain, and fibromyalgia. Its antioxidant properties also support long-term wellness.

  • Related Study

Anti-lipidaemic and anti-inflammatory effect of açai (Euterpe oleracea Martius) polyphenols on 3T3-L1 adipocytes

This study investigates the anti-lipidaemic and anti-inflammatory effects of açai polyphenols in mouse adipocytes. Açai polyphenols were shown to reduce lipid accumulation and downregulate key adipogenic transcription factors, while increasing adiponectin levels. Additionally, açai polyphenols protected against oxidative stress and decreased pro-inflammatory cytokines, especially when challenged with TNF-α. These results suggest that açai polyphenols could be beneficial in preventing adipogenesis, oxidative stress, and inflammation, potentially useful in managing obesity-related conditions.

Turmeric

  • What is it?

Turmeric is a bright yellow spice derived from the Curcuma longa plant, known for its pow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ant compound, curcumin.

  • What are the benefits for Pain?

Curcumin, the active compound in turmeric, blocks inflammatory pathways, providing relief for pain caused by conditions such as arthritis, tendinitis, and muscle injuries.

  • How does it contribute to Wellness?

Turmeric contributes to overall wellness by reducing chronic inflammation, which is linked to various diseases. It enhances joint health, improves mobility, and helps in the long-term management of pain without side effects associated with conventional painkillers.

  • Which problems can it solve?

Turmeric is effective in treating chronic inflammation and pain associated with arthritis, fibromyalgia, and sports injuries. It also helps to reduce stiffness and improve joint function.

Quercetin

  • What is it?

Quercetin is a plant pigment (flavonoid) found in many fruits and vegetables. It has potent an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ties.

  • What are the benefits for Pain?

Quercetin reduces inflammatory markers in the body, making it effective for managing chronic pain conditions like rheumatoid arthritis. It also inhibits the production of histamines, reducing the sensation of pain and inflammation.

  • How does it contribute to Wellness?

As an antioxidant, quercetin fights free radicals, which cause cellular damage and contribute to inflammation. This helps improve overall immune function and reduces chronic pain, leading to better health and longevity.

  • Which problems can it solve?

Quercetin helps in reducing the severity of arthritis, muscle pain, and post-injury inflammation. It’s beneficial for those suffering from autoimmune diseases and chronic inflammatory conditions.

  • Related Study

Quercetin supplementation and inflammatory pain in rheumatoid arthritis

A 2012 study showed that quercetin supplementation significantly reduced pain and inflammation in patients with rheumatoid arthritis.
